Looking thru the data a little more grades are great. However looking at the angle of the drill hole to the deposit it is angled quite a bit and they don't state the true width. Meaning they are drilling along the deposit and not directly thru it. Indicating the deposit is narrower than the drill report states. I really wish they would provide this true width info. I get it they want to make it look as good as possible but if you know what you're looking in these types of releases you know it doesn't paint the true picture.
